ESD safety shoes, lace-up, uvex motion style, 6998
Shoes and Boots
Ultralight, perforated ESD safety shoe made from breathable high-tech microvelour, soft padded collar and tongue, breathable distance mesh and an extremely flexible dual density PUR sole (slip-, abrasion- and cut-resistant, resistant to oil and petrol and withstands brief exposure to heat of approx. 120 °C). Free of lacquer wetting inhibitors such as silicones or phthalates.

  • Climazone technology for improved comfort
  • Breathable distance mesh lining
  • Removable anti-static comfort insole with moisture control system; orthopaedic insoles possible
  • Anti-twist heel cap for better stability and protection from ankle twisting
  • uvex 3D hydroflex® foam insole for exceptional shock absorption in the heel and under the front of the foot
  • Virtually seamless design to eliminate the potential for pressure points and blisters
  • Elastic laces for quick and individual adjustment
  • Protective steel toecap (200 J)
  • Fulfils ESD requirements: Resistance to ground inferior to 35 megaohms

Suitable for people allergic to chrome.

Colour: Black/grey or Black/red.

Certifications: EN 61340 (ESD); DGUV112-191; EN ISO 20345:2011; S1, SRC
